Container Truck Tips Over Onto School Bus

PATTAYA – January 29, 2014 [PDN]; at 7.00 a.m. Pol. Lt. Nijjasan Phuaphansri (investigation officer of Banglaumung police station, Chonburi province) was notified that there was an accident where container truck had collided with a school shuttle van and many students were injured. The incident occurred on highway no. 36 (Kathing Lai – Rayong), route to Pattaya, Moo 3 Tambon Nong Pla Lai, Amphur Banglamung, Chonburi province, so he rushed to inspect the scene together with the police team and the rescuers of Sawang Boriboon Tharmma Satharn foundation, Pattaya city.

At the incident the officers found the bronze Toyota van, license number NOR NGOR – 819 Chonburi, a school shuttle van of Srisuwit Pattaya School, was parked in the middle of the road and was severely damaged at the front. It was carrying a total of 22 kindergarten and primary students. A total of 8 students had been with cuts and scratches so the rescuers performed first aid for them then sent the injured students to Bangkok hospital (Pattaya).

Upon questioning Mr. Manit Singsomboon, aged 57, who was the van driver, he said that before incident occurred he was taking picking up students to take them to school. He then saw the container truck which was swaying and suddenly 2 containers fell off and smash into the van and the truck lost control and tipped over.
Mr. Natthaphol Phoka, aged 24, who was the truck driver, said that he was driving from Rayong province to Laem Chabang port and when he arrived at the incident point there was a curve and a pickup truck was parked on the left lane so he swerved to miss it causing the 2 containers to fall off smashing into the van.

However, after initial investigation then the police took the photos and made a record about the accident for evidence and detained Mr. Natthaphol (the truck driver) to prosecute him with allegations of driving carelessly causing injury to other people.

Reporter : Samart   Photo : Samart
